Research Diagnostic Sonographer Job Trends in Newport

If you’re a Diagnostic Sonographer curious about Travel job trends in Newport, OR,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 4 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,623 and a range from $2,112 to $3,412 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 97365, at reputable facilities such as Pacific Communities Health District.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Diagnostic Sonographers in Newport’s thriving healthcare landscape. What Types of Work and Facilities Can Diagnostic Sonographers Expect in Newport, OR?

As a Diagnostic Sonographer in Newport, Oregon, you will have the opportunity to work in a variety of healthcare settings that cater to a diverse patient population. In this charming coastal city, facilities range from community hospitals and specialized clinics to outpatient imaging centers and health systems focused on delivering comprehensive care. Your role will encompass performing high-quality ultrasound imaging, assisting in the diagnosis and treatment of medical conditions, and collaborating with physicians to interpret results. With Newport’s blend of scenic beauty and access to multiple healthcare facilities, you can expect a fulfilling career that not only enhances your skills in abdominal, obstetric, and vascular sonography but also allows you to make meaningful contributions to patient care in a supportive and dynamic environment.

Frequently Asked Questions about Travel Diagnostic Medical Sonography Jobs near Newport, OR

What is the average pay for a Diagnostic Medical Sonography Travel job in Newport, Oregon?

The average pay for a Diagnostic Medical Sonography Travel job in Newport, Oregon is approximately $2,623 per week. This data was last updated on February 17, 2026.

What is the highest pay typically available for a Diagnostic Medical Sonography Travel job in Newport, Oregon?

The highest pay typically available for a Diagnostic Medical Sonography Travel job in Newport, Oregon is $3,412 per week. This is based on data last updated on February 17, 2026.

What types of experience are required or preferred for a DMS Travel job in Newport?

Candidates for a Diagnostic Medical Sonography travel job in Newport, Oregon typically need to possess an accredited sonography degree along with certification from a recognized professional body, such as the American Registry for Diagnostic Medical Sonography (ARDMS). Preferred experience often includes proficiency in various imaging modalities and familiarity with hospital settings to ensure adaptability in different clinical environments.
